Despite intensive preventive cardiovascular disease (CVD) efforts, substantial residual CVD risk remains even for individuals receiving all guideline-recommended interventions. Niacin is an essential micronutrient fortified in food staples, but its role in CVD is not well understood. Abstract 13719: Minimal and Delayed Age-Related Increase of Arterial #Stiffness Among Tsimane Forager-Horticulturalists

Background: Tsimane forager-farmers of the Bolivian Amazon exhibit a distinct trajectory of vascular aging, characterized by low age-related increases in BP, the lowest levels of coronary calcification ever reported, and robust VO2 max.
